Department faculty receive Florida Center for Cybersecurity Collaborative Seed Awards

March 6, 2017

The Florida Center for Cybersecurity has awarded $600,000 in funding for 2016-2017 to twelve projects involving cybersecurity researchers from nine State University System institutions. Included in this list of awardees are two faculty from the Department of Computer Science and Engineering:

Collaborative Authentication for the Internet of Things

  • Jay Ligatti, PI, University of South Florida
  • Daniela Oliveira, Co-PI, University of Florida

Software-defined Overlay Virtual Networks – Enforcing Private Device-to-Device Communication through Social Contexts

  • Renato Figueiredo, PI, University of Florida
  • Adriana Iamnitchi, Co-PI, University of South Florida
